前端之家收集整理的这篇文章主要介绍了
ruby – 将多个变量与单个表达式中的值进行比较,
前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
我有两个变量a和b.我想比较a和b两个值,比如说10.
我可以这样做:
10 == a && 10 == b
但是,我想知道是否有任何方法可以在单个表达式中编写它? (例如a = = b == 10)
[a,b,3].all? {|x| x==10}
但在这种情况下
[].all? {|x| x==10}
也会回归真实
原文链接:https://www.f2er.com/ruby/267471.html